    Haghartsin Monastery

    Hidden deep in the Dilijan National Park, the Haghartsin Monastery (10th–13th centuries) is one of Armenia’s spiritual treasures. Surrounded by dense forest, its stone churches and khachkars (cross-stones) create a mystical atmosphere. According to legend, “hagh” means play and “artsin” means eagle, because eagles were once seen flying above the monastery during its construction and lunch at local restaurant (lunch price is not included)

    Monastery Sevanavank

    Perched on a peninsula overlooking Lake Sevan, Sevanavank (9th century) offers breathtaking panoramic views. Originally built on an island (before Soviet water engineering lowered the lake’s level), the monastery was once a spiritual retreat for monks and a key cultural center of Armenia.

    Lake Sevan

    Known as the “Pearl of Armenia,” Lake Sevan is one of the largest high-altitude freshwater lakes in the world. Relax by its shores, take stunning photos, or taste Armenia’s famous Sevan trout in one of the local restaurants.
